Investbox, Cryptotalk, Yo-token, Now Virtual-Mining.

Yesterday i received this email from Yobit newsletter:
Quote
New: YoBit Virtual Mining!

Dear YoBit Users!

Buy Virtual Miner and get income in tokens every day!

When buying a miner, 90% of btc funds goes to buy support for the Minex (Virtual Mining Token) in Minex/BTC trade pair

With every purchase of a miner, the Minex/BTC support price increases by 0.1%

10% of the cost of the miner goes to the buyback of the Yo token (in the Yo/BTC pair)

Try it now: https://yobit.net/en/mining/


Sincerely yours,
Team of Yobit.Net

Honestly, i can't understand well how this may work as a mining opportunity. What to mine and for what purpose?
According to yobit.net/en/mining , Virtual miners costs between 0.1 btc and 5 btc !! I am really curious to know if there are people who believe in this shady offer and buy it for real.



For everybody reading this, Stay Away from this platform and never believe anything coming from Yoshit.

If anyone can explain how this virtual miner can legitimately make any investor money, I'd love to hear an explanation
It can't. It's a scam. Have a read of my post here: https://bitcointalk.org/index.php?topic=5217581.msg53650350#msg53650350. This is essentially exactly the same but instead of being shilled through the "InvestBox" it is being shilled through these "Virtual Miners".

This "token" sprang in to existence out of nothing 3 days ago. If you try to deposit or withdraw it, you are told the wallet is in "maintenance", which is the same error message you get on all these scam tokens. The X10 token from my post above has been in "maintenance" since January. These tokens do not exist. You cannot deposit or withdraw them. There is no blockchain or smart contract. They are a creation of Yobit and only exist on Yobit. They are not cryptocurrencies in any way.

You spend bitcoin, you earn a fake token, either from InvestBox or Virtual Miners - it doesn't matter. You can maybe dump some of your fake token on later suckers to get back a fraction of your BTC if you are lucky. More likely, you lose all your BTC and are left holding millions of a fake token that nobody will buy.

The X10 token from above currently has a 126 billion of these tokens stacked up for sale at 1 satoshi, with zero volume and zero buyers. MINEX will look exactly the same in a few months, but not before Yobit have managed to scam plenty more bitcoin out of idiots buying these non-existent "virtual miners".

Hhhhh .. Yesterday, i received another Yobit email describing the daily/monthly profit for each mining level, without describing anything about the mining process itself.

Quote
YoBit Virtual Mining!

Dear YoBit Users!

Buy Virtual Miner and get income in tokens every day!


- Micro Miner:
Est Daily Btc: 0.00012330 , USD: $1.43, Monthly Btc: 0.00382230, USD: $44.33

- Light Miner:
Est Daily Btc: 0.00137000 , USD: $15.95, Monthly Btc: 0.0424700, USD: $494.45

- Standart Miner:
Est Daily Btc: 0.00753500 , USD: $87.74, Monthly Btc: 0.233585, USD: $2719.94

- Pro Miner:
Est Daily Btc: 0.01644000 , USD: $191.45, Monthly Btc: 0.50964, USD: $5934.95

- Vip Miner:
Est Daily Btc: 0.10275000 , USD: $1196.57, Monthly Btc: 3.1852, USD: $37093.67


When buying a miner, 90% of btc funds goes to buy support for the Minex (Virtual Mining Token) in Minex/BTC trade pair

With every purchase of a miner, the Minex/BTC support price increases by 0.1%

10% of the cost of the miner goes to the buyback of the Yo token (in the Yo/BTC pair)

Try it now: https://**************


Sincerely yours,
Team of Yobit.Net

So if you purchase the VIP-miner which costs 5 btc, you will get 3.1 btc per month.  Cheesy
That's terribly insane !
